Tuning: Standard


    A    A7   C    C7   D    Em   G6
e --0----0----0----0----2----0----0--|
B --2----2----1----0----3----0----0--|
G --2----0----0----0----2----0----0--|
D --2----2----2----2----0----2----0--|
A --0----0----3----3----0----2----2--|
E --0----0----0----0----2----0----3--|

Phrase 1: Em   G6   C7   A7
Phrase 2: Em   D    C    A    G    C

Notes:
- Most chords are played with a variation of the above and a common morph of the above.
- "Em", "A", "C7", and "G6" regularly morphs by raising a "D" on the "B" string.
- A & A7 morph between one another, different from verse to verse.
